Down ticket, way down, building the Progressive Movement (and Democratic Party) from ground up!

by: Karita Hummer

Thu Apr 03, 2008 at 13:49:58 PM EDT

Down ticket all the way down, building the Progressive Movement (and the Democratic Party) from the ground up!!

Today, is a quite lovely day in San Jose, CA, and I am preparing a fundraiser for one of the best down ticket candidates one could find, for Santa Clara County Supervisor, Richard Hobbs..  

Now, Santa Clara County is known world-wide for the Silicon Chip and all that has gone with it.  (Sadly, forgotten are the old orchards that made it the Garden of Heart's Delight some years ago.)  What is not known maybe as widely is that we have lots of poverty here, too, many, many in the working poor (right alongside and in the shadow of the Silicon Valley giants) as well as discrimination, high rates of incarceration, pollution, and too much civic disengagement as well, because of how busy people are here running around in this valley industry, where the working poor hold two jobs (to the detriment of their children) and the working affluent work 60 - 70 hours + (to the detriment of their children.)

Now, here comes Richard Hobbs, running because of his strong advocacy for the working poor, for human rights and justice in all matters, the celebration and protection of diversity, for clean campaign money and transparency, for cleaning up our environment and for being a voice for peace in the world, from a County pulpit. In other words, Richard is for the common good.  (Sound familiar, Edwards Democrats?)

It is imperative to get Richard Hobbs elected as County Supervisor in Santa Clara County, and all the other Richard Hobbs running for local offices, and on up the ticket. That is the way to build our progressive movement and to take our government back for the common good. Therefore, I encourage all Edwards Democrats, to look around at what (true) progressives might be running for City Council or County Supervisor or even County Party Councils and give them a boost by helping their campaigns.  Thus, will we begin to take back our Party, and our Country.  Think globally, act locally, and eventually, I believe we will prevail.
